/third_party/ffmpeg/libavutil/ |
H A D | colorspace.h | 30 #define SCALEBITS 10 macro 31 #define ONE_HALF (1 << (SCALEBITS - 1)) 32 #define FIX(x) ((int) ((x) * (1<<SCALEBITS) + 0.5)) 58 r = cm[(y + r_add) >> SCALEBITS];\ 59 g = cm[(y + g_add) >> SCALEBITS];\ 60 b = cm[(y + b_add) >> SCALEBITS];\ 74 y = (y1) << SCALEBITS;\ 75 r = cm[(y + r_add) >> SCALEBITS];\ 76 g = cm[(y + g_add) >> SCALEBITS];\ 77 b = cm[(y + b_add) >> SCALEBITS];\ [all...] |
/third_party/ffmpeg/tests/ |
H A D | utils.c | 26 #define SCALEBITS 8 macro 27 #define ONE_HALF (1 << (SCALEBITS - 1)) 28 #define FIX(x) ((int) ((x) * (1 << SCALEBITS) + 0.5)) 57 FIX(0.11400) * b + ONE_HALF) >> SCALEBITS; in rgb24_to_yuv420p() 65 FIX(0.11400) * b + ONE_HALF) >> SCALEBITS; in rgb24_to_yuv420p() 76 FIX(0.11400) * b + ONE_HALF) >> SCALEBITS; in rgb24_to_yuv420p() 84 FIX(0.11400) * b + ONE_HALF) >> SCALEBITS; in rgb24_to_yuv420p() 87 FIX(0.50000) * b1 + 4 * ONE_HALF - 1) >> (SCALEBITS + 2)) + 128; in rgb24_to_yuv420p() 89 FIX(0.08131) * b1 + 4 * ONE_HALF - 1) >> (SCALEBITS + 2)) + 128; in rgb24_to_yuv420p()
|
/third_party/skia/third_party/externals/libjpeg-turbo/ |
H A D | jccolext.c | 62 ctab[b + B_Y_OFF]) >> SCALEBITS); in rgb_ycc_convert_internal() 65 ctab[b + B_CB_OFF]) >> SCALEBITS); in rgb_ycc_convert_internal() 68 ctab[b + B_CR_OFF]) >> SCALEBITS); in rgb_ycc_convert_internal() 109 ctab[b + B_Y_OFF]) >> SCALEBITS); in rgb_gray_convert_internal()
|
H A D | jdcol565.c | 53 SCALEBITS))]; in ycc_rgb565_convert_internal() 66 SCALEBITS))]; in ycc_rgb565_convert_internal() 75 SCALEBITS))]; in ycc_rgb565_convert_internal() 88 SCALEBITS))]; in ycc_rgb565_convert_internal() 134 SCALEBITS)), d0)]; in ycc_rgb565D_convert_internal() 148 SCALEBITS)), d0)]; in ycc_rgb565D_convert_internal() 159 SCALEBITS)), d0)]; in ycc_rgb565D_convert_internal() 174 SCALEBITS)), d0)]; in ycc_rgb565D_convert_internal()
|
H A D | jdmrg565.c | 49 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v1_merged_upsample_565_internal() 74 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v1_merged_upsample_565_internal() 121 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v1_merged_upsample_565D_internal() 148 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v1_merged_upsample_565D_internal() 195 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v2_merged_upsample_565_internal() 235 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v2_merged_upsample_565_internal() 293 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v2_merged_upsample_565D_internal() 337 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v2_merged_upsample_565D_internal()
|
H A D | jdmrgext.c | 52 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v1_merged_upsample_internal() 77 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v1_merged_upsample_internal() 126 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v2_merged_upsample_internal() 167 cgreen = (int)RIGHT_SHIFT(Cbgtab[cb] + Crgtab[cr], SCALEBITS); in h2v2_merged_upsample_internal()
|
H A D | jccolor.c | 65 #define SCALEBITS 16 /* speediest right-shift on some machines */ macro 66 #define CBCR_OFFSET ((JLONG)CENTERJSAMPLE << SCALEBITS) 67 #define ONE_HALF ((JLONG)1 << (SCALEBITS - 1)) 68 #define FIX(x) ((JLONG)((x) * (1L << SCALEBITS) + 0.5)) 408 ctab[b + B_Y_OFF]) >> SCALEBITS); in cmyk_ycck_convert() 411 ctab[b + B_CB_OFF]) >> SCALEBITS); in cmyk_ycck_convert() 414 ctab[b + B_CR_OFF]) >> SCALEBITS); in cmyk_ycck_convert()
|
H A D | jdmerge.c | 50 #define SCALEBITS 16 /* speediest right-shift on some machines */ macro 51 #define ONE_HALF ((JLONG)1 << (SCALEBITS - 1)) 52 #define FIX(x) ((JLONG)((x) * (1L << SCALEBITS) + 0.5)) 187 RIGHT_SHIFT(FIX(1.40200) * x + ONE_HALF, SCALEBITS); in build_ycc_rgb_table() 190 RIGHT_SHIFT(FIX(1.77200) * x + ONE_HALF, SCALEBITS); in build_ycc_rgb_table()
|
H A D | jdcolor.c | 76 #define SCALEBITS 16 /* speediest right-shift on some machines */ macro 77 #define ONE_HALF ((JLONG)1 << (SCALEBITS - 1)) 78 #define FIX(x) ((JLONG)((x) * (1L << SCALEBITS) + 0.5)) 236 RIGHT_SHIFT(FIX(1.40200) * x + ONE_HALF, SCALEBITS); in build_ycc_rgb_table() 239 RIGHT_SHIFT(FIX(1.77200) * x + ONE_HALF, SCALEBITS); in build_ycc_rgb_table() 349 ctab[b + B_Y_OFF]) >> SCALEBITS); in rgb_gray_convert() 560 SCALEBITS)))]; in ycck_cmyk_convert()
|
/third_party/skia/third_party/externals/libjpeg-turbo/simd/i386/ |
H A D | jccolor-avx2.asm | 21 %define SCALEBITS 16 45 PD_ONEHALFM1_CJ times 8 dd (1 << (SCALEBITS - 1)) - 1 + \ 46 (CENTERJSAMPLE << SCALEBITS) 47 PD_ONEHALF times 8 dd (1 << (SCALEBITS - 1))
|
H A D | jccolor-mmx.asm | 21 %define SCALEBITS 16 45 PD_ONEHALFM1_CJ times 2 dd (1 << (SCALEBITS - 1)) - 1 + \ 46 (CENTERJSAMPLE << SCALEBITS) 47 PD_ONEHALF times 2 dd (1 << (SCALEBITS - 1))
|
H A D | jccolor-sse2.asm | 20 %define SCALEBITS 16 44 PD_ONEHALFM1_CJ times 4 dd (1 << (SCALEBITS - 1)) - 1 + \ 45 (CENTERJSAMPLE << SCALEBITS) 46 PD_ONEHALF times 4 dd (1 << (SCALEBITS - 1))
|
H A D | jcgray-avx2.asm | 21 %define SCALEBITS 16 39 PD_ONEHALF times 8 dd (1 << (SCALEBITS - 1))
|
H A D | jcgray-mmx.asm | 21 %define SCALEBITS 16 39 PD_ONEHALF times 2 dd (1 << (SCALEBITS - 1))
|
H A D | jcgray-sse2.asm | 20 %define SCALEBITS 16 38 PD_ONEHALF times 4 dd (1 << (SCALEBITS - 1))
|
H A D | jdcolor-avx2.asm | 22 %define SCALEBITS 16 44 PD_ONEHALF times 8 dd 1 << (SCALEBITS - 1)
|
H A D | jdcolor-mmx.asm | 21 %define SCALEBITS 16 43 PD_ONEHALF times 2 dd 1 << (SCALEBITS - 1)
|
H A D | jdcolor-sse2.asm | 21 %define SCALEBITS 16 43 PD_ONEHALF times 4 dd 1 << (SCALEBITS - 1)
|
H A D | jdmerge-avx2.asm | 22 %define SCALEBITS 16 44 PD_ONEHALF times 8 dd 1 << (SCALEBITS - 1)
|
H A D | jdmerge-mmx.asm | 21 %define SCALEBITS 16 43 PD_ONEHALF times 2 dd 1 << (SCALEBITS - 1)
|
H A D | jdmerge-sse2.asm | 21 %define SCALEBITS 16 43 PD_ONEHALF times 4 dd 1 << (SCALEBITS - 1)
|
/third_party/skia/third_party/externals/libjpeg-turbo/simd/x86_64/ |
H A D | jccolor-avx2.asm | 21 %define SCALEBITS 16 45 PD_ONEHALFM1_CJ times 8 dd (1 << (SCALEBITS - 1)) - 1 + \ 46 (CENTERJSAMPLE << SCALEBITS) 47 PD_ONEHALF times 8 dd (1 << (SCALEBITS - 1))
|
H A D | jccolor-sse2.asm | 20 %define SCALEBITS 16 44 PD_ONEHALFM1_CJ times 4 dd (1 << (SCALEBITS - 1)) - 1 + \ 45 (CENTERJSAMPLE << SCALEBITS) 46 PD_ONEHALF times 4 dd (1 << (SCALEBITS - 1))
|
H A D | jcgray-avx2.asm | 21 %define SCALEBITS 16 39 PD_ONEHALF times 8 dd (1 << (SCALEBITS - 1))
|
H A D | jcgray-sse2.asm | 20 %define SCALEBITS 16 38 PD_ONEHALF times 4 dd (1 << (SCALEBITS - 1))
|